Output 66446729febccca6238adbfd57f4e32dfe52c8b6bcd585aacc07fee10c2e6095:2

value
198349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e8a23152327a3701d2d6c9fdfcdc3cc3de2fa4 OP_EQUAL
address
3KeB3ohbAzFSiigWQqKzpyHYY7fPWBT5dN
transaction
66446729febccca6238adbfd57f4e32dfe52c8b6bcd585aacc07fee10c2e6095
spent
true